Skin radiance is no longer viewed as a superficial outcome of topical treatments alone. A growing body of research and expert consensus indicates that sustained luminosity emerges from the interplay of nutrition, physical activity, and daily micro-habits. This 360-degree examination explores how these elements converge to influence cellular function, hydration, and long-term skin health, offering a framework for individuals seeking measurable, enduring results.

Scope and Historical Context
The concept of “glow from within” is not new. Traditional Chinese Medicine and Ayurveda have long emphasized internal balance as the foundation of external beauty. However, the modern scientific validation of these principles began in the early 2000s with studies on the gut-skin connection. By 2015, research from the National Institutes of Health confirmed that gut microbiota imbalances could exacerbate conditions like acne, eczema, and rosacea. This period also saw the rise of “nutricosmetics”—oral supplements designed to enhance skin elasticity, hydration, and UV resistance.
Stakeholders in this ecosystem include:
- Dermatologists and estheticians: Advocating for evidence-based protocols that complement clinical treatments.
- Nutritionists and dietitians: Designing meal plans rich in antioxidants, omega-3 fatty acids, and probiotics.
- Fitness professionals: Developing routines that optimize blood flow and reduce cortisol, a known contributor to collagen breakdown.
- Consumers: Driving demand for transparency in ingredient sourcing and efficacy data.
- Regulatory bodies: The FDA and EFSA monitor claims around supplements and functional foods, though enforcement remains inconsistent.

Operational Mechanics: How Diet, Movement, and Habits Interact
Skin health operates on a feedback loop where internal and external factors continuously influence one another. Below is a breakdown of the mechanisms at play:
Nutrition for Cellular Function
Nutrient-dense foods provide the building blocks for collagen synthesis, sebum regulation, and antioxidant defense. Key components include:
- Omega-3 fatty acids: Found in fatty fish, flaxseeds, and walnuts, these reduce inflammation and support the skin’s lipid barrier. A 2021 study in Dermatologic Therapy reported a 35% reduction in inflammatory lesions among participants consuming 2 grams of omega-3s daily for 10 weeks.
- Vitamin E and selenium: These neutralize free radicals generated by UV exposure and pollution. Brazil nuts, sunflower seeds, and spinach are rich sources.
- Polyphenols: Compounds in green tea, dark chocolate, and berries enhance microcirculation and protect against photoaging. A 2020 trial in Photodermatology, Photoimmunology & Photomedicine found that green tea extract reduced UV-induced DNA damage by 25%.
Movement and Circulatory Health
Physical activity enhances skin radiance through two primary pathways: increased blood flow and lymphatic drainage. A 2022 study in Experimental Dermatology observed the following effects:
| Activity Type | Duration | Observed Skin Benefit | Mechanism |
|---|---|---|---|
| Moderate cardio (e.g., jogging, cycling) | 30 minutes, 3x/week | 18% increase in skin hydration | Enhanced microcirculation delivers oxygen and nutrients to dermal layers |
| Resistance training (e.g., weightlifting) | 45 minutes, 2x/week | 12% improvement in elasticity | Mechanical stress stimulates fibroblast activity and collagen production |
| Yoga and stretching | 60 minutes, 2x/week | 28% reduction in cortisol levels | Activates parasympathetic nervous system, reducing oxidative stress |
Daily Micro-Habits for Cumulative Impact
Small, consistent actions compound over time to produce visible results. Dermatologist Dr. Whitney Bowe, author of The Beauty of Dirty Skin, emphasizes: “The skin’s microbiome and barrier function are highly responsive to daily habits. Even minor adjustments, like swapping a sugary snack for a handful of almonds or taking a 10-minute post-lunch walk, can shift the skin’s trajectory from reactive to resilient.”
Critical micro-habits include:
- Hydration timing: Consuming 500ml of water upon waking jumpstarts cellular hydration, as dehydration peaks overnight. A 2023 study in International Journal of Cosmetic Science found that participants who followed this practice had 15% higher skin moisture levels after four weeks.
- Sleep positioning: Sleeping on silk pillowcases reduces friction and prevents sleep lines, which can evolve into permanent wrinkles. A survey by the American Academy of Dermatology found that 67% of respondents noticed fewer facial creases after switching to silk.
- Digital detox: Blue light from screens accelerates photoaging. A 2021 study in Journal of Biomedical Physics & Engineering showed that two hours of daily screen time increased oxidative stress markers in skin cells by 22%.

Systemic Impacts and Stakeholder Perspectives
The shift toward holistic skincare has ripple effects across industries and demographics. Below are key perspectives from diverse stakeholders:
Industry Adaptation
Beauty brands are reformulating products to align with the “inside-out” philosophy. Procter & Gamble’s Olay Regenerist line now includes a supplement with collagen peptides and hyaluronic acid, while Glow Recipe has partnered with nutritionists to offer meal plans alongside its skincare products. “Consumers are no longer satisfied with surface-level solutions,” says Sarah Lee, co-founder of Glow Recipe. “They want products that work in harmony with their lifestyle.”
Regulatory Challenges
The FDA’s stance on supplements remains a point of contention. While the Dietary Supplement Health and Education Act of 1994 allows manufacturers to market products without pre-approval, the agency has issued warnings about misleading claims. In 2022, the FDA sent warning letters to 10 companies for promoting supplements as acne or wrinkle treatments without substantiated evidence. “The lack of standardization creates a Wild West scenario,” says Dr. Pieter Cohen, an associate professor at Harvard Medical School. “Consumers deserve transparency about what these products can and cannot do.”
Consumer Behavior
A 2023 survey by McKinsey & Company found that 68% of skincare consumers now prioritize products with “clean” ingredients, while 45% seek brands that offer educational content on nutrition and lifestyle. However, adherence to holistic regimens remains a challenge. A study in Journal of Cosmetic Dermatology reported that only 30% of participants maintained a consistent routine for more than six months, citing time constraints and lack of immediate results as primary barriers.
Environmental and Ethical Considerations
The demand for nutrient-dense foods has intensified scrutiny of agricultural practices. Sustainable sourcing of ingredients like omega-3-rich algae and vitamin E-packed avocados is now a priority for brands like True Botanicals and Tata Harper. “Ethical sourcing isn’t just a marketing tactic—it’s a necessity,” says Tata Harper, founder of her eponymous brand. “Consumers are increasingly aware of the environmental impact of their choices, and they expect brands to reflect those values.”
Emerging research continues to refine our understanding of the gut-skin axis, with ongoing studies exploring the role of postbiotics—metabolites produced by probiotics—in skin barrier repair. The National Institutes of Health has allocated $12 million to a five-year study investigating the link between microbiome diversity and aging, with preliminary results expected in 2025. Meanwhile, wearable technology, such as smart patches that monitor hydration levels in real time, is poised to revolutionize personalized skincare. These innovations, coupled with evolving regulatory frameworks, will shape the next decade of holistic skincare, blurring the lines between beauty, wellness, and preventive medicine.
